Application Roles
• Permissions assigned to this role
• No users added
• Role is “invoked” by user and secured by a password
• Once invoked, permissions remain the same as long as the session is active.

DDL Triggers
• Similar to triggers in previous versions
• These operate on data definition statements (CREATE, DROP, etc).
• Best used for auditing changes to the schema
• Multiple triggers can be assigned to an event
© Wiley Inc. 2006. All Rights Reserved.
DDL Triggers – cont’d
• Two scopes– Server level – logins, endpoints, other server
level objects– Database level – users and other database
level objects
• Events at each level are hierarchial• Can trigger on Event groups or Events• User EVENT DATA instead of inserted
and deleted tables

SQL Server Agent Roles
• Three New Roles– SQLAgentUserRole– SQLAgentReaderRole– SQLAgentOperatorRole
• Allow delegation of job responsibilities to non-sysadmin users
• Limited to jobs and history• Proxies greatly expanded for many more
subsystems

.NET Assembly Security
• Created with any .NET language• Registered with Windows host• SAFE Permissions
– Limited to data access inside a SQL Server instance
• EXTERNAL_ACCESS– Allows access inside SQL instance,
Windows host file system, local registry, and web services
© Wiley Inc. 2006. All Rights Reserved.
.NET Assembly Security – cont’d
• UNSAFE Permissions– Completely unrestricted– Can access memory buffers, legacy
COM components, etc.– Must be created by sysadmin– Be very careful before allowing
UNSAFE assemblies
